We’re currently recruiting for a Financial Accountant to join the Finance Team. In this role, you will play a central role within finance, with responsibility for the US reporting, playing a key part in advancing our mission and making a real difference. 

 

Your responsibilities in this role would be:

  • Managing financial reporting within the enterprise resource planning (ERP) system, ensuring reporting is timely, accurate and compliant with financial reporting standards, including balance sheet reconciliations and cash flow reporting.
  • Overseeing the management reporting pack, ensuring contributions from other team members provide detailed analysis and commentary on results for business reporting.
  • Conducting financial reviews associated with payroll, bonus and share-based remuneration.
  • Managing cash flow reporting and medium-term business unit cash planning and reporting.
  • Maintaining relationships with stakeholders across the business to account for and report development revenues generated by the UK site.
  • Developing a strong understanding of the ERP system and related processes to act as the ERP expert within the Finance team.
  • Completing reporting analysis and commentary to explain variances within the Finance team for business reporting purposes.
  • Participating in the preparation of year-end audit documentation with the wider team.

 

We are looking for:

  • Qualified accountant (ACCA, CIMA or equivalent) with proven experience in finance within an international or global business environment.
  • Strong technical accounting and audit knowledge, including financial reporting and ERP systems.
  • Advanced MS Excel skills with the ability to analyse and interpret financial data.
  • Strong communication and stakeholder management skills, with a flexible and adaptable approach.

 

About Us:

OXB is a quality and innovation-led viral vector CDMO with a mission to enable its clients to deliver life changing therapies to patients around the world. One of the original pioneers in cell and gene therapy, we have more than 30 years of experience in viral vectors; the driving force behind the majority of gene therapies.

OXB collaborates with some of the world’s most innovative pharmaceutical and biotechnology companies, providing viral vector development and manufacturing expertise in lentivirus, adeno-associated virus (AAV), and adenoviral vectors. OXB’s world-class capabilities span from early-stage development to commercialisation. These capabilities are supported by robust quality-assurance systems, analytical methods, and depth of regulatory expertise.
